Output d4aee0234eac134d6a0c0294e6052352b83e3de5b01813af4a984a51ea66e199:3

value
23377176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ae450ea150b8fe26dcae9ccebd76bcb9334cead OP_EQUAL
address
MLZYzagdqSEoUf16B2FVcaN1pYoE4KVYfs
transaction
d4aee0234eac134d6a0c0294e6052352b83e3de5b01813af4a984a51ea66e199
spent
true